Pakistan’s Contingent Ready to Compete in 5th World Nomad Games 2024

Published

on

Pakistan’s combined contingent is set to participate in the 5th World Nomad Games, taking place in Astana from September 7 to 14, 2024. The opening ceremony will be held on September 8, where Malik Sajjad Hussain Awan will lead the Pakistani team. The team will compete in a variety of traditional sports including Tug of War, Mas-Wrestling, Kurash, Traditional Wrestling, Mind Games, Traditional Archery, and Powerful Nomad.

Rana Muhammad Jameel, the General Secretary of the Pakistan Tug of War Federation, will serve as Chef de Mission for the team.

The World Nomad Games are an international event that celebrates the heritage of nomadic cultures and traditional sports from across the globe. With athletes from over 100 countries participating, the games foster a sense of unity and competition in age-old sports.

“We are proud to represent Pakistan in these historic games and look forward to showcasing the strength, skills, and spirit of our athletes,” said Rana Jameel.

Pakistan’s participation highlights its dedication to promoting and reviving traditional sports on the international stage. The Pakistani team members are eager to demonstrate their talents and make their mark in the prestigious event.
